Ayoub El Kaabi scored a treble as Greece side Olympiacos stunned English outfit Aston Villa 4-2 in the first leg of their UEFA Europa Conference League semi-final match at Villa Park on Thursday night.

Aston Villa have a big obstacle to overcome, going into the second leg of the encounter in Greece on Thursday, as they are looking to reach the final of a European competition for the first time since 1982.

In the opening 30 minutes of the match, Aston Villa fell to a quick 2-0 Olympiacos upset. El Kaabi scored in the 16th and 29th minutes, but Ollie Watkins put one back for the hosts just before the halftime break.

Seven minutes into the second half, Aston Villa were back in the game after Moussa Diaby put Leon Bailey’s assist behind the net from a very tight angle to make it 2-2.

However, Olympiacos regained the lead four minutes after Diaby’s goal. El Kaabi scored from the spot to complete his hat-trick before Santiago Hezze sealed the win with his 67th-minute strike.

Meanwhile, Fiorentina defeated 10-man Club Brugge 3-2 in the first leg of the second Europa Conference League semi-final tie at the Artemio Franchi Stadium in Italy on Thursday.

Five minutes into the encounter, Riccardo Sottil opened the scoring for Fiorentina, but Hans Vanaken equalised for Club Brugge in the 17th minute. Andrea Belotti regained the lead for Fiorentina in the 37th minute.

Super Eagles midfielder Raphael Onyedika was sent off in the 61st after a second yellow, but Club Brugge somehow managed to equalise again three minutes later through Thiago Rodrigues despite being one man down.

However, a late M’Bala Nzola goal in the first minute of the five minutes of added time secured a crucial home win for Fiorentina going into the second leg in Belgium next week Thursday.
